SynopsisPagan men - straight, gay, bisexual, polyamorous, plumbers, programmers, shopkeepers, writers, musicians, drummers - define themselves in a faith community that honours strong women in what many believe are women's religions. Using interviews with over 40 Pagan men, leading authority on earth religions Isaac Bonewits looks at the sons of the Goddess, covering issues he has dealt with himself as a Pagan for over 40 years. He reveals today's practitioner as a trailblazer with his own specific symbols and magical correspondences, calling to Goddesses AND Gods., Isaac Bonewits has interviewed over forty pagan men to divine the issues they are facing in communities that honour strong women. Today's practitioners are blazing new trails into unknown social, cultural and political territories and they have their own rituals, rites of passage and symbols.
